§205A-43.5 - Powers and duties of the authority.
[§205A-43.5] Powers and duties of theauthority. (a) Prior to action on a variance application, the authorityshall hold a public hearing under chapter 91. By adoption of rules underchapter 91, the authority may delegate responsibility to the department. Public and private notice, including reasonable notice to abutting propertyowners and persons who have requested this notice, shall be provided, but apublic hearing may be waived prior to action on a variance application for:
(1) Stabilization of shoreline erosion by the movingof sand entirely on public lands;
(2) Protection of a legal structure costing more than$20,000; provided the structure is at risk of immediate damage from shorelineerosion;
(3) Other structures or activities; provided that noperson or agency has requested a public hearing within twenty- five calendardays after public notice of the application; or
(4) Maintenance, repair, reconstruction, and minoradditions or alterations of legal boating, maritime, or watersports recreationalfacilities, which result in little or no interference with natural shorelineprocesses.
(b) The authority shall either act on varianceapplications or, by adoption of rules under chapter 91, delegate theresponsibility to the department. [L 1989, c 356, pt of §1]
